2026-07-072026-07-07http://salesiana.dossiersoluciones.com/handle/123456789/122204Given a multigraded algebra $A$, it is a natural question whether or not for two homogeneous components $A_u$ and $A_v$, the product $A_{nu}A_{nv}$ is the whole component $A_{nu+nv}$ for $n$ big enough.
